Shovels & Rope return to childhood

Friday, February 5, 2021 – The husband-and-wife duo that comprise Shovels & Rope - Cary Ann Hearst and Michael Trent - have gone the children's route on "Busted Juice Box Vol 3." The collection is geared towards children's songs with help from other artists, who are parents. Sharon Van Etten helps out on The Beach Boys' "In My Room." The War and Treaty, John Paul White, members of Deer Tick, The Secret Sisters and The Felice Brothers all lend their support . Songs include "Tomorrow" with The War and Treaty, "My Little Buckaroo" with M. Ward and "What a Wonderful World" with White.

Uncle Walt's Band, which consisted of Walter Hyatt, Champ Hood and David Ball, originally put out 15 songs in a private pressing of a live disc recorded in Austin four decades ago. The music is being resurrected with 21 songs on a disc from Omnivore.

After putting out his first solo album in four decades a few years ago, Rod Abernethy did not wait so long to release "Normal Isn't Normal Anymore." The North Carolina native recalls The Avett Brothers vocally.
